Hi HN, I created this site recently and need som feedbacks. Please give it a try, let me know if you see anything to need to be improved or added. Below is the summary of https://hichatbot.ai

What is HiChatbot? - HiChatbot is an AI-powered chatbot that can answer your questions about documents, text, and videos. You can upload a document, text, or provide a video link to HiChatbot and have a Q&A chat with the content.

What are some of the things I can do with HiChatbot? You can use HiChatbot to: - Summarize the main points of a document - Get more details about a specific topic in a document, text, or video - Based on the provided document, generate creative text formats of text content, like executive summaries, reports, poems, code, scripts, musical pieces, email, letters, etc.

I haven’t used it but I’m pretty sure that HN readers tend to appreciate if you had provided a privacy policy and a terms of service.

Otherwise, at the minimum, make it clear in your FAQ.

Some questions that I have floating around:

- Who’s processing my data? OpenAI? A service from AWS? Bare metal with your own solution?

- What are the limitations? Would a 1 hour lecture video off YouTube work?

Slight nitpick: You’ve got a domain name, why don’t you use that as your contact email? It would be nicer, in my eyes, to have something like “<your first name>@hichatbot.ai” instead of “hichatbotai@gmail.com”.
